STINNER Victor added the comment: If I understood correctly, supporting the "wide mode" for wprintf() requires to modify all calls to functions like printf() in Python and so it requires to change a lot of code. Since this issue was the first time that I heard about wprintf(), I don't think that we should change Python. I'm not going to fix this issue except if much more users ask for it.
